To use visual search so you can see the pic- ture, be sure VCR appears, then begin tape playback. Press FAST-Fto search forward or REW to search in reverse. Press PLAY to return to normal playback.

During visual search, the sound is muted and the picture quality is lower than during normal playback. The search picture is best with tapes recorded at the SP or SLP speed (see “Re- cording Speeds/Tape Selection” on Page 38).

Freeze-Frame/Frame Advance

Freeze-frame lets you pause the tape to view a single frame. Press PAUSE during playback to freeze the picture. Press PAUSE again or PLAY to return to normal playback.

During freeze-frame, picture quality is lower than during normal playback. The picture quali- ty is best with recordings made at the SP or SLP speed (see “Recording Speeds/Tape Se- lection” on Page 38).

Notes:

If you leave the VCR in the freeze-frame mode for 3 minutes, the VCR stops playing the tape to protect the video heads.

To reduce or eliminate jitter in the freeze- frame picture, hold down CH s or t until the picture is clear.

During freeze-frame, you can advance the pic- ture one frame at a time by repeatedly pressing SLOW. This feature works best with video cas- settes recorded at the SP or SLP speed. Press PAUSE or PLAY to return to normal playback.

REAL-TIME COUNTER

Using the Counter

Your VCR’s counter shows how long a tape has been running. To see the counter on the TV screen, press DISP/ENT on the remote con- trol.

The counter resets to 0:00:00 each time you put in a tape. To manually reset the counter, press COUNTER RESET.

Note: The real-time counter might stop if you fast-forward or rewind through a blank section on the tape. This is normal.
